PPP Poll: Americans Don’t Trust Trump on Supreme Court Vacancy; 65% Want Hearings
Public Policy Polling ^ | 05/09/2016 | Tom Jensen, Director of Public Policy Polling

Posted on 05/09/2016 12:19:00 PM PDT by SeekAndFind

From: Tom Jensen, Director of Public Policy Polling

To: Interested Parties

Subject: Americans Don’t Trust Trump on Supreme Court Vacancy; 65% Want Hearings

Date: 5-9-16

A new national Public Policy Polling survey finds Americans don’t trust Donald Trump to nominate a new Supreme Court justice, and would much rather have that decision in the hands of either Barack Obama or Hillary Clinton.

Beyond that, there is growing support for filling the seat this year and failure to do so could result in strong backlash for Senate Republicans this fall.

Key findings from the survey include:

-Only 38% of voters nationally trust Donald Trump to nominate a Supreme Court justice, compared to 53% who don’t trust him to do that. Only 57% of voters even within his own party trust Trump to make a selection, and more than 80% of Democrats as well as a majority of independents don’t trust him with that responsibility.

-Americans, by double digit margins, trust both Barack Obama and Hillary Clinton more with the duty of picking a Supreme Court justice than Trump. Obama beats Trump 53/37 on that question, and Clinton does by a similar 52/37 spread as well. What’s particularly noteworthy is that in addition to more than 80% of Democrats, 29% of Republicans would prefer either Obama or Clinton making that decision to their own party’s presumptive nominee for President.

-By a 58/37 spread, Americans want the Supreme Court seat to be filled this year. That’s actually up from 56/40 support for filling it this year on a national PPP poll in early March. The reason for the shift is that 39% of Republicans now think the seat should be filled immediately, up from just 26% two months ago.
